Dishes
Charcoal-Grilled Pig SkinCharcoal-grilled pig skin is a dish made primarily with pig skin, grilled over charcoal. The skin is processed to be soft, with a crispy exterior and unique texture.
Charcoal-Grilled Crispy DuckCharcoal-Grilled Crispy Duck is a dish made with duck meat, marinated and then grilled over charcoal. The skin is crispy, and the meat is tender with a rich flavor.
Charcoal-Grilled Shu Nu TiepiCharcoal-Grilled Shu Nu Tiepi is a Sichuan dish made with tiepi, a type of starch-based noodle, and grilled over charcoal with seasoning. The tiepi, made from sweet potato starch, has a smooth texture and is crispy on the outside with a soft inside, offering a spicy and delicious flavor.
